Theory is great, but execution is what matters. This section is where the rubber meets the road. We’ll break down the automation pipeline into three distinct, manageable steps. We’ll move from raw, disparate data to a polished, AI-generated PDF report, using the powerful trio of Google Sheets, Gemini, and Google Docs, all orchestrated by Genesis Engine AI Powered Content to Video Production Pipeline.
Before we can analyze or summarize anything, we need a single source of truth. A Google Sheet serves as the perfect staging area—a structured, API-accessible repository for all the data that will fuel our report. Our first task is to write an Apps Script function that programmatically pulls data from various sources into this central sheet.
The Process:
Set Up Your Master Sheet: Create a new Google Sheet. Let’s call it “Quarterly_Ops_Master”. Create separate tabs for each data source you need to consolidate, for example: Sales_CRM_Data, Marketing_Analytics, Support_Tickets.
Orchestrate with Apps Script: Open the script editor by going to Extensions > Apps Script. We’ll write a primary function, collectAllData(), to act as our conductor, calling helper functions to fetch data for each source.
Fetch the Data: The specific code will vary based on your data sources, but here are a few common patterns.
SpreadsheetApp.openById() to access the source sheet and copy the relevant data over.
// In your Apps Script project
const MASTER_SHEET_ID = 'YOUR_MASTER_SHEET_ID';
const SALES_SOURCE_SHEET_ID = 'SOURCE_SHEET_ID_FOR_SALES';
function fetchSalesData() {
const masterSheet = SpreadsheetApp.openById(MASTER_SHEET_ID).getSheetByName('Sales_CRM_Data');
const sourceSheet = SpreadsheetApp.openById(SALES_SOURCE_SHEET_ID).getSheets()[0]; // Assuming data is on the first tab
// Get all data from the source
const sourceData = sourceSheet.getDataRange().getValues();
// Clear old data and paste new data
masterSheet.clearContents();
masterSheet.getRange(1, 1, sourceData.length, sourceData[0].length).setValues(sourceData);
Logger.log('Successfully fetched sales data.');
}
UrlFetchApp to make HTTP requests. You’ll need to handle authentication (often with an API key or OAuth2), but the basic structure is simple.
function fetchSupportTickets() {
const API_ENDPOINT = 'https://api.your-support-desk.com/v1/tickets?status=closed&period=q3';
const API_KEY = 'YOUR_SECRET_API_KEY'; // Use PropertiesService for better security
const options = {
'method': 'get',
'headers': {
'Authorization': 'Bearer ' + API_KEY
},
'muteHttpExceptions': true
};
const response = UrlFetchApp.fetch(API_ENDPOINT, options);
const tickets = JSON.parse(response.getContentText());
// Now, write a function to parse 'tickets' and write them to the 'Support_Tickets' tab
// ...
}
function collectAllData() {
fetchSalesData();
// fetchMarketingData(); // You would create this function
// fetchSupportTickets(); // And this one...
Logger.log('All data sources have been updated.');
}
Finally, set up a time-driven trigger (Triggers tab in the Apps Script editor) to run collectAllData() automatically on a schedule (e.g., daily or weekly) to ensure your master sheet is always up-to-date.
With our data neatly centralized, we can now call in the AI. The goal here is not just to summarize, but to synthesize—to find the story within the data. We’ll feed the structured numbers and text from our Sheet to Gemini 1.5 Pro and ask it to generate the insightful narrative that forms the core of our report.
The Process:
Enable the [Building Self Correcting Agentic Workflows with Building Self-Correcting Agentic Workflows with Vertex AI](https://votuduc.com/building-self-correcting-agentic-workflows-with-vertex-ai-p-20260321542526) API: In your script’s Google Cloud Platform project, make sure the “Vertex AI API” is enabled. In the Apps Script editor, go to Services + and add the VertexAI advanced service.
Prepare Data for the Prompt: Models like Gemini work best with clean, well-formatted input. A raw data dump is less effective than a structured text format like Markdown or JSON. We’ll write a function to convert our sheet data into a Markdown table.
function getSheetDataAsMarkdown(sheetName) {
const sheet = SpreadsheetApp.openById(MASTER_SHEET_ID).getSheetByName(sheetName);
const data = sheet.getDataRange().getValues();
if (data.length < 2) return ''; // Not enough data for a header and a row
const headers = data[0];
const rows = data.slice(1);
let markdownTable = `| ${headers.join(' | ')} |\n`;
markdownTable += `| ${headers.map(() => '---').join(' | ')} |\n`;
rows.forEach(row => {
markdownTable += `| ${row.join(' | ')} |\n`;
});
return markdownTable;
}
function generateReportNarrative() {
const salesMarkdown = getSheetDataAsMarkdown('Sales_CRM_Data');
const marketingMarkdown = getSheetDataAsMarkdown('Marketing_Analytics');
// The project number is found in your GCP project settings
const projectNumber = 'YOUR_GCP_PROJECT_NUMBER';
const location = 'us-central1'; // Or your preferred location
const model = 'gemini-1.5-pro-latest';
const prompt = `
You are an expert business operations analyst tasked with creating a quarterly report summary.
Your audience is the executive leadership team. Your tone should be professional, concise, and insightful.
Analyze the following data for Q3 2024.
**Sales Data:**
${salesMarkdown}
**Marketing Metrics:**
${marketingMarkdown}
**Your Task:**
Generate a narrative for the quarterly report with the following structure:
1. **Executive Summary:** A 3-4 sentence high-level overview of the quarter's performance.
2. **Key Wins:** 3-5 bullet points highlighting major successes, supported by specific data points.
3. **Identified Challenges:** 2-3 bullet points on areas that need improvement or faced headwinds.
4. **Actionable Recommendations:** 2-3 forward-looking suggestions for the next quarter based on your analysis.
`;
const request = {
contents: [{
role: 'user',
parts: [{ text: prompt }]
}]
};
const endpoint = `https://` + location + `-aiplatform.googleapis.com/v1/projects/` + projectNumber + `/locations/` + location + `/publishers/google/models/` + model + `:generateContent`;
const options = {
method: 'POST',
headers: {
'Authorization': 'Bearer ' + ScriptApp.getOAuthToken(),
'Content-Type': 'application/json'
},
payload: JSON.stringify(request),
muteHttpExceptions: true
};
const response = UrlFetchApp.fetch(endpoint, options);
const responseData = JSON.parse(response.getContentText());
// Extract the generated text from the complex JSON response
const narrative = responseData.candidates[0].content.parts[0].text;
Logger.log(narrative);
return narrative;
}
This function now gives us a high-quality, AI-generated text block containing the core analysis for our report, ready to be placed into a professional document.
The final step is presentation. A block of text, no matter how insightful, isn’t a report. We need to package our data and narrative into a polished, branded document. Using a Google Doc as a template is the perfect way to achieve this.
The Process:
{{double_curly_braces}}.Title: Quarterly Operations Report - {{report_quarter}}
Body:
{{executive_summary}}
{{key_wins}}
…and so on. You can also have a placeholder for a data table, like {{sales_table}}.
const TEMPLATE_DOC_ID = 'YOUR_TEMPLATE_DOCUMENT_ID';
const DESTINATION_FOLDER_ID = 'FOLDER_ID_FOR_REPORTS';
function createReportDocument() {
// First, get the AI narrative
const fullNarrative = generateReportNarrative();
// NOTE: You'd need to parse the 'fullNarrative' string to separate the summary, wins, etc.
// For simplicity, we'll assume we have them in variables.
const executiveSummary = "This is the AI-generated executive summary...";
const keyWins = "These are the AI-generated key wins...";
// Get the destination folder and template file
const destinationFolder = DriveApp.getFolderById(DESTINATION_FOLDER_ID);
const templateFile = DriveApp.getFileById(TEMPLATE_DOC_ID);
// Create a copy of the template for this quarter's report
const reportName = `Q3 2024 Operations Report`;
const newReportFile = templateFile.makeCopy(reportName, destinationFolder);
// Open the new document to edit it
const doc = DocumentApp.openById(newReportFile.getId());
const body = doc.getBody();
// Replace all text placeholders
body.replaceText('{{report_quarter}}', 'Q3 2024');
body.replaceText('{{executive_summary}}', executiveSummary);
body.replaceText('{{key_wins}}', keyWins);
// ... and so on for all placeholders
// (Optional but powerful) Programmatically insert a data table
const salesData = SpreadsheetApp.openById(MASTER_SHEET_ID).getSheetByName('Sales_CRM_Data').getDataRange().getValues();
body.appendParagraph('Detailed Sales Data').setHeading(DocumentApp.ParagraphHeading.HEADING2);
body.appendTable(salesData);
doc.saveAndClose();
// Create the PDF
const pdfBlob = newReportFile.getAs('application/pdf');
pdfBlob.setName(reportName + '.pdf');
const pdfFile = destinationFolder.createFile(pdfBlob);
Logger.log(`Report generated: ${pdfFile.getUrl()}`);
// Clean up the Google Doc version
// DriveApp.getFileById(newReportFile.getId()).setTrashed(true);
return pdfFile;
}
With this final function, you have a complete, end-to-end pipeline. A single call to createReportDocument() will now trigger the entire chain: data collection, AI synthesis, and professional document generation, leaving you with a ready-to-share PDF in your Google Drive.

One of the most significant challenges in any organization is the siloed nature of data. Sales data lives in one system, marketing analytics in another, and customer support logs in a third. Manually correlating these disparate datasets is a monumental task, meaning deep, cross-functional insights are often left undiscovered.
Gemini excels at synthesizing information from multiple sources within your Automated Discount Code Management System. By pointing it to different Google Sheets, Docs, and even summarized email threads, you can ask questions that were previously too complex or time-consuming to answer.
Connecting the Dots: You can ask Gemini to analyze sales figures from a Sheet against marketing campaign performance detailed in a Doc and customer sentiment extracted from Google Forms. This could reveal a crucial insight: a specific marketing campaign drove a high volume of low-quality leads that ultimately had a low conversion rate and high customer churn, a pattern invisible to the marketing and sales teams looking only at their own metrics.
Identifying Leading Indicators: By analyzing support ticket themes alongside product usage data, you might identify a leading indicator for customer churn. For instance, a spike in tickets mentioning “billing confusion” could predict a wave of cancellations 30 days later. This allows the organization to address the root cause before it impacts revenue, transforming the support function from a cost center to a strategic intelligence unit.
